about summary refs log tree commit diff
diff options
context:
space:
mode:
authorAneesh Agrawal <aneeshusa@gmail.com>2018-09-18 09:30:22 -0700
committerAneesh Agrawal <aneeshusa@gmail.com>2018-10-15 19:59:25 -0700
commita962d538068cdf00025e73181d17572492f68008 (patch)
treec9b090cb3fac8795f2ddbc25282c9d48ff5cf677
parent37c9915340357226d2c9090425e9566feb7bb159 (diff)
downloadnixlib-a962d538068cdf00025e73181d17572492f68008.tar
nixlib-a962d538068cdf00025e73181d17572492f68008.tar.gz
nixlib-a962d538068cdf00025e73181d17572492f68008.tar.bz2
nixlib-a962d538068cdf00025e73181d17572492f68008.tar.lz
nixlib-a962d538068cdf00025e73181d17572492f68008.tar.xz
nixlib-a962d538068cdf00025e73181d17572492f68008.tar.zst
nixlib-a962d538068cdf00025e73181d17572492f68008.zip
salt: Restart on config changes
-rw-r--r--nixos/modules/services/admin/salt/master.nix3
-rw-r--r--nixos/modules/services/admin/salt/minion.nix3
2 files changed, 6 insertions, 0 deletions
diff --git a/nixos/modules/services/admin/salt/master.nix b/nixos/modules/services/admin/salt/master.nix
index 165580b97837..c6b1b0cc0bd8 100644
--- a/nixos/modules/services/admin/salt/master.nix
+++ b/nixos/modules/services/admin/salt/master.nix
@@ -53,6 +53,9 @@ in
         Type = "notify";
         NotifyAccess = "all";
       };
+      restartTriggers = [
+        config.environment.etc."salt/master".source
+      ];
     };
   };
 
diff --git a/nixos/modules/services/admin/salt/minion.nix b/nixos/modules/services/admin/salt/minion.nix
index 254ff7bb899a..c8fa9461a209 100644
--- a/nixos/modules/services/admin/salt/minion.nix
+++ b/nixos/modules/services/admin/salt/minion.nix
@@ -58,6 +58,9 @@ in
         Type = "notify";
         NotifyAccess = "all";
       };
+      restartTriggers = [
+        config.environment.etc."salt/minion".source
+      ];
     };
   };
 }